ARCH 210

Spring 2007 All Classes

All Classes

Credit: 3 hours.

Visual and cultural analysis of selected buildings, urban spaces, and cities, from ancient Greece to modern times; emphasizes the architectural traditions of Western Civilization, especially as they affect the built environment of America and the Middle West.

Prerequisite: Sophomore standing or consent of instructor.
